2 Degrees
2degrees is a brand new mobile phone network, to really turn up the heat in New Zealand's mobile market. With 2degrees, you will get real choice for mobile calling and texting as well as simple, fair mobile phone pricing - making it easy to stay in touch with the people you know.
Warehouse Stationery is proud to stock a range of new 2 degrees mobile phones and SIM cards ? available in store and online, PLUS you?ll be able to top up at any of our 46 Warehouse Stationery stores!
Why join the 2degrees network?
2degrees want to put you in control - and give you the freedom to use your mobile phone whenever and however you want.
Mobile Phone Numbers
- You can bring your existing mobile phone number with you to 2degrees! If you are on another mobile network in New Zealand and you bring any 021, 027, 028 or 029 number to 2degrees, you will get $5 credit FREE!
- Because 2degrees is a new network, there are more than 10 million new 022 numbers up for grabs. 2degrees is giving you one free chance to change your mobile phone number to something a bit more personal e.g. 022 2255726 (022 Call Sam).
- To swap over to the 2degrees network and keep your number or change it to something more personal, simply visit www.2degreesmobile.co.nz and register for ?Your 2degrees?. If you require assistance, please call the 2degrees Customer Care team on 0800 022 022. This process usually takes 24 hours.
Coverage
- The 2degrees mobile phone network coverage is great ? with coverage of 97% of the places that people live and work in New Zealand.
- Customers with Mobile Internet capable handsets will be able to use data across their national network for browsing the web or applications like Google Maps, Facebook, Bebo, Stuff and many others.
Payment Options
- With 2degrees you have control by paying in advance for what you plan to use there are no unpleasant surprises and no contracts!
Topping Up
- You can top-up your 2degrees mobile using a voucher bought from any of our 46 Warehouse Stationery stores. Customers purchase top-ups in-store for $20 to $100 (or any $10 increment in-between).
- All top-ups on 2degrees are ?magic?, which means you get free stuff when you top-up!
Other services
- When any 2degrees SIM is activated, Caller ID and VoiceMail Box services are included, at no additional cost (retrieval costs apply).
- You will be able to roam internationally to the majority of destinations popular with Kiwi travellers.
